La Ninkasi du Faubourg

Bars and Pubs


If you are looking for somewhere to hang out, watch a game, play some pool or sing karaoke, then Ninkasi is the place to be. We offer a range of activities for you to enjoy. Our great location—right on rue St–Jean—means you can spend a really eclectic evening at a spot that is easy to get to! We only serve beer from Québec microbreweries and food from local producers. So kick back and relax in a laid-back atmosphere with some tunes playing in the background. You'll feel right at home.
